No increase in water quota
CHANDIGARH, Dec 21— Following a virtual refusal by the Central Government to give its nod for the revised plan of the fourth phase of the augmentation of the water supply scheme at Kajauli village, near here, the Municipal Corporation of Chandigarh (MCC) has now decided to start work on the earlier scheme to bring only 20 million gallons of water per day (MGDs).

Police hushing up other cases, too
CHANDIGARH, Dec 21 — After the infamous missing files case earlier this year, the Chandigarh police has allegedly been hushing other cases also. Little is known about 10 cases registered at the Sector 26 police station 15 to 19 years ago.

No consensus on alliance candidate
CHANDIGARH, Dec 21— Even as an Akali councillor, Ms Harjinder Kaur, withdrew her nomination from the post of Senior Deputy Mayor today, the consensus on who is the official BJP-SAD alliance candidate for the post of the Deputy Mayor continues to elude the alliance.

RI for assaulting conductor
CHANDIGARH, Dec 21 — Convicting four residents of Khuda Ali Sher of assaulting a bus conductor, the UT Judicial Magistrate (first class), Mrs Jatinder Walia, today sentenced them to rigorous imprisonment for six months, besides imposing a fine of Rs 1300 each.

Compensation not paid
KHARAR, Dec 21 — Kaka Singh, a resident of nearby Manana village, whose 42 goats were reportedly killed by a wild animal, has not been provided any compensation in spite of promises made by a minister.

Vegetable prices stable
SAS NAGAR, Dec 21 — Prices of commonly-used vegetables in the local markets have remained unchanged during the past few weeks. While a superior quality of potato was being sold by a vendor in Phase 5 market for Rs 5 a kg, another cheaper variety was available for Rs 4 a kg.
